Notori-goya (農鳥小屋)
Notori-goya is a small, strategically placed ridge hut + tent site in Japan’s Southern Alps, located on the saddle between Mt. Ainodake and Mt. Nishi-Notori-dake on the main ridgeline. It’s a classic traverse-stage base: you use it to split long 3,000 m-class ridge days, manage weather windows, and keep safe margins in a very exposed section of the Southern Alps.
